Ulse INC. (the "organization") develops and publishes consensus standards that help guide the safety and sustainability of new and evolving products, technologies, and services by providing assurance to the public that products are designed, constructed, and tested to withstand demanding, normal-use conditions without presenting risk of danger or injury. Standards are developed through a rigorous, collaborative, and transparent multi-stage process that brings together experts, regulators, industry representatives, and consumers to identify criteria that reflect current scientific knowledge, support innovation, and represent the interests of consumers. Once finalized, the organization publishes its standards online and disseminates them to testing, inspection and certification companies, enabling manufacturers, regulators, and end users to access shared reference points that elevate safety, drive responsible development, and protect communities. In addition to its standards, the organization's educational activities include the publication of news and informational resources authored by engineers, technologists, data scientists, and policy experts to help the public understand evolving safety risks in a rapidly changing technological landscape, thereby empowering communities to make informed decisions, adopt safer practices, and reduce the risk of harm in everyday life.
